For a country to be good at IMO, they need a few things. May be not all of them to the extreme, some things could compensate for others. Generally you need (1) large population, so that you have enough naturally talented kids (2) a system to find these kids (3) a system to train these kids for specific IMO style problems. There is nothing you can do about(1). For (2) and (3) you need some good coaches and a lot of government support.

India beats others in 1st point in the extreme level which is why we are doing well in both IMO and also IOI in recent years. Just because India has some of the richest men of the earth but it doesn't means average Indians are rich.

Some autocratic countries like Iran/North Korea/Russia have the 2nd point and 3rd point at an extreme which is why they performed so well.

China has all the three points together so it no surprise that they perform so well.
